Not Independent

Note: You should include this disclosure if you receive commissions from insurance providers. Venture Wealth receives commissions from the relevant insurer when we provide advice in relation to life insurance products. For this reason, we are not able to refer to ourselves as 'independent', 'impartial', or 'unbiased' under section 923A of the Corporations Act 2001. However, we always act in the best interests of our clients.

The Advice Process

  1. Initial Consultation: We discuss your current situation and goals.
  2. Statement of Advice (SOA): If we provide personal advice, we will present it in a written SOA, outlining our recommendations, the basis for them, and any associated fees or commissions.
  3. Record of Advice (ROA): For further advice, we may use an ROA which you can request at any time.



How We Are Remunerated

Venture Wealth is committed to fee transparency. You will be advised of the specific fees and commissions before we proceed with any work.


Advice Fees

  • Initial Advice Fee: A flat fee for the preparation and implementation of your Statement of Advice.
  • Ongoing Service Fee: A fee for the ongoing management and review of your financial strategy, typically charged as a flat dollar amount or a percentage of assets under management.

Commissions

  • Insurance Commissions: We may receive a commission from the insurance provider. This is not an additional cost to you and is paid by the insurer from the premium.


Professional Indemnity Insurance

Venture Wealth maintains Professional Indemnity Insurance that meets the requirements of the Corporations Act 2001 and covers the services provided by our representatives, including former representatives for work performed while they were with us.
